proIPyrroline-5-carboxylate reductase; Catalyzes the reduction of 1-pyrroline-5-carboxylate (PCA) to L-proline. (272 aa)
iscRDNA-binding transcriptional dual regulator 2Fe-2S cluster IscR; Regulates the transcription of several operons and genes involved in the biogenesis of Fe-S clusters and Fe-S-containing proteins. (163 aa)
speCOrnithine decarboxylase; Function of homologous gene experimentally demonstrated in an other organism; enzyme; Belongs to the Orn/Lys/Arg decarboxylase class-II family. (387 aa)
PP_0949Putative ATP-binding protein UPF0042; Displays ATPase and GTPase activities. (284 aa)
prrGamma-aminobutyraldehyde dehydrogenase; Function of homologous gene experimentally demonstrated in an other organism; enzyme; Belongs to the aldehyde dehydrogenase family. (474 aa)
